Given stack sizes, flop bet size, and the fact that MP was the pre-flop raiser, I like a push here.
Obviously you do not have as much equity vs his calling range as if you had AcJc or Tc9c but I would expect your overcard outs, or at least three of them, to be good quite often and your flush outs almost always. |

I don't like his flop betsize and he either hit or has an over pair. Hence, we have no folding equity and I like calling in position. I also want UTG to come along, that would be owesome.
Shoving is the worst line - it defines your hand too well and makes his decision easier. If you want to raise, make it $13, but I much rather prefer a call. |
